Hi..i have two four year old bonded boars outside and very happy. I have been asked to adopted a young boar which will be outside in a seperate hutch (6mths) and getting him a friend. My comcerns are relating to my old boys. Will they be upset and start to fight if they can see the other boar or smell them? Thanks for any advice..
 
They should be able to live fine nearby each other.... just don’t introduce them. We have friends who had two pairs of boars in same room two on top and two on bottom.

I have 3 pairs of boars in the same room, they are absolutely fine. They love to look out for each other through the bars at floor time and have a friendly chat. Only one pair at a time are actually lose in the room they don't meet other than through the bars of the cage.
